Privacy Commissioner Expresses Concern Over Google Street View

The Privacy Commissioner of Canada has released a public letter she recently sent to Google expressing misgivings about the privacy implications of Google Street View. The Commissioner is of the view that the service, which has not yet been introduced in Canada, may not comply with Canadian privacy law.

Canadian Privacy Commissioners Call for Suspension of No-Fly List

Canadian privacy commissioners from coast to coast have passed a resolution calling on the government to suspend the recently launched no-fly list.
